House Fire Relief- Funds for Judy and Michael

Donation protected
Early this morning on Tuesday September 28th 2021, Judy and Michael's house caught fire. At this point, we don't know why or how, we just know that the fire itself was bad and has done significant damage to the house. Both Michael and Judy have been hospitalized. Thankfully Michael is awake and stable but our dear friend Judy is fighting for her life in the ICU.

What we do know is that internally she has burns and inhalation smoke damage. Judy has had multiple cardiac arrests and is intubated and currently not awake at this time. We don't know what recovery looks like, and the family is taking each moment as it comes.

Judy is a nurse and runs the Cabarrus Pets Society. She is a huge part of our community and is truly one of the kindest humans to walk this earth. She takes care of the sick and hurting, she is a force of nature for all creatures, a wonderful mom, an amazing friend, and a beloved spouse. She is the human being who says yes to helping others and does all that she can to make a difference in our world. We treasure her, and we all want her to make a full recovery so she can grace us with that smile once more.

As a huge lover of animals, the family has a mighty crew of fur babies at home. Sadly, one of her cats did not make it, another is missing, and the others are being treated and cared for by her friends in her rescue.
